Indian cement manufacturers are significantly intensifying their efforts to decarbonise operations, driven by a dual imperative: sustainability commitments and the need for enhanced cost competitiveness. The sector, which is crucial for India’s infrastructure development, is a substantial contributor to greenhouse gas emissions, making its transition to greener practices a national priority. Leading companies are increasingly adopting renewable energy sources, improving energy efficiency, and exploring advanced technologies to reduce their carbon footprint.
The cement industry in India, the world’s second-largest market, is characterized by robust demand fueled by urbanisation, infrastructure projects, and housing needs. As of the end of FY26, the country’s cement production capacity stood at 718 million tonnes per annum (MTPA), with projections indicating a further addition of 100 million tonnes of grinding capacity by FY28. Recognizing the environmental impact of cement production, manufacturers are charting ambitious net-zero emission roadmaps, with many setting targets for the next 15 to 20 years.
Shift Towards Green Power and Energy Efficiency
A key strategy being deployed across the industry is the increased adoption of green power. Cement makers are stepping up efforts to integrate renewable energy into their overall energy mix. This transition is largely supported by the implementation of waste heat recovery systems (WHRS), which capture and convert heat generated during the cement production process into electricity for captive use. Beyond WHRS, companies are also investing heavily in wind and solar power capacities.
Companies like Ramco Cements have already commissioned significant WHRS capacity, reducing their reliance on purchased power and increasing their green energy share. Ramco Cements reported that in FY26, approximately 40% of its energy requirements were met through green power, a notable increase from 36% in the previous fiscal year, driven primarily by improved wind power generation.
Rating agency Icra highlights that Indian cement companies are planning a substantial increase in their green power capacity, projecting it to grow from around 4.0 GW in March 2026 to 5.8-6.0 GW by March 2028. This expansion is backed by planned investments of approximately ₹12,000-13,000 crore over the next two years. The additional green energy capacity is expected to generate annual savings in the range of ₹6,200-6,700 crore, with an estimated payback period of 1.8 to 2.2 years.
Adoption of Alternative Fuels and Blended Cement
In addition to green power, the industry is focusing on increasing the use of alternative fuels and the production of blended cement. Alternative fuels, such as biomass and refuse-derived fuel, are being co-processed in cement kilns to replace conventional fossil fuels, thereby reducing reliance on finite resources and lowering emissions. While the current thermal substitution rate (TSR) in India is around 6%, some plants have achieved significantly higher usage, and the industry is working towards increasing this metric.
The production of blended cement, which incorporates industrial by-products like fly ash or slag, is another critical decarbonisation lever. This practice reduces the need for clinker, the most energy-intensive component in cement production, leading to a substantial cut in embodied CO2 emissions. The Indian cement industry has a strong track record in this area, with blended cement accounting for a significant portion of the total cement produced.
Exploring Advanced Technologies
Looking ahead, the cement sector is also evaluating and exploring more advanced technologies, including carbon capture, utilisation, and storage (CCUS). The Indian government has proposed significant financial outlays to support the deployment of CCUS across key industries, including cement, signalling a concerted effort to tackle hard-to-abate emissions.
Companies are also investing in process efficiency improvements, digital transformation, and optimising logistics to further reduce their environmental impact. For instance, UltraTech Cement has implemented digital solutions and AI-based monitoring systems in its mining operations to enhance efficiency and reduce carbon emissions. The company has also been a pioneer in co-processing waste materials in cement kilns, diverting waste from landfills and reducing fossil fuel consumption.
The sustainability agenda is not only driven by environmental concerns but also by the growing emphasis on Environmental, Social, and Governance (ESG) compliance. Investors, lenders, and regulators are increasingly scrutinizing companies’ environmental performance, pushing the cement industry to adopt cleaner and more responsible manufacturing practices. This proactive approach to decarbonisation is seen as vital for maintaining long-term operational competitiveness and meeting India’s national climate goals, including its commitment to net-zero emissions by 2070.
